Cheese "Cake" (Prajitura cu branza)

So this is an interesting cake, it's called a cheesecake but it's not your traditional cheesecake with cream cheese.





This is yet another traditional Romanian recipe that I just love.  It's an easy to make cake, and the big difference between this cake and your traditional cheesecake is this is made with ricotta cheese.  This cake is light, and it's delicious. Here are the ingredients you'll need to make this cake:

  • 4 eggs
  • 1 cup of sour cream
  • 1 cup of sugar
  • 1/2 tsp baking powder
  • 2 tbsp butter
  • 1 cup of flour
  • 500g of ricotta cheese
Preheat the oven at 375 degrees.  In a mixer, add 2 of the eggs and 1/2 cup of the sugar and mix well until light and fluffy. Add the sour cream and the melted butter and mix well.  Add the flour and the baking powder, and mix well.

In another bowl mix the ricotta with the remainder of the sugar and the remaining 2 eggs and mix well.  You may also add raisins with ricotta if you wish.  Personally I like a few raisins in this cake, so now would be the time to add about 1/2 cup of raisins.

You can use a cheesecake pan, butter it well.  Pour the cake batter first, then pour the ricotta mix in the middle.  Do not mix.  Bake until golden brown.  Let cool before serving.  You may also sprinkle some powdered sugar on top of the cake.

Easy and delicious.
